The application and admission process at Clarks Summit University is quite simple and it includes a total of 4 steps that are as follows: Step 1: Submitting the application The first step which a candidate is required to make for admission at Clarks Summit University is applying to the university. Interested candidates can either apply online or by calling the university at (570) 586-2400. Alternatively, they can also directly visit the university's admissions office at 538 Venard Rd, South Abington Township, Pennsylvania 18411-1250. Otherwise, they can contact Clarks Summit University's admissions office by phone in order to take admission. Step 2 to the application and admission process: Acceptance by CSU The applicant would be required to submit necessary documents to receive an admission decision once they have submitted the form and deposited the enrollment fee. For Clarks Summit University, applicants will have to submit the following documents: Essay: Also known as a personal statement, the essay provides the applicant with an opportunity in a unique way to showcase their achievements and personality. Personal experience and anecdotes of the applicant can also be included. Transcripts: Applicants must also submit high-school and university transcripts for the evaluation process. They can submit the same through Parchment (or similar platforms). Official Test Scores: By submitting these official scores, the applicant can avail of a better chance of securing a seat at Clarks Summit University. The university may request additional documents or information from the applicants once the reviewing process is over. Step 3: Confirm Your Attendance The candidates have to confirm their attendance to Clarks Summit University to complete the third step. The candidates will be required to complete their Financial Check-In process and select their housing, too. These processes include reviewing and verifying the summary of Accounts and Financial Aid (scholarships, fees, and tuition costs), choosing a lodging option, selecting a payment plan, and making the first payment as well. Before proceeding to register for classes, candidates also have to complete the Math and English assessments. Step 4: Register for Classes The candidates have to register for courses once all the processes mentioned above are completed.

Most universities in the US incentivize students by helping them obtain university credits through certain courses, which are available in high school. Some of such popular programs available for the students include AP Credit, CLEP (Credit for Life Experiences), and Dual Enrollment (also known as Dual Credit). Different colleges have different policies regarding such credits. These programs are designed to provide various benefits to students, such as a shorter time to complete a degree, increased chances of finising a degree, and a higher GPA. Students who are interested in these courses and want to avail CLEP and AP credits can simply visit collegeboard.org and request to submit the scores to any university of their choice.
